ABSTRACT: | Golden Mile Resources (ASX: G88) (“Golden Mile” or “Company”) is pleased to announce that drilling continues to return significant nickel intercepts, with exploration extending the mineralised envelope to the granite boundary, west of the existing drill pattern at the Company’s Quicksilver Nickel project in the South-West Mineral Field of Western Australia. Executive Director Tim Putt said: ‘We’ve extended our drilling pattern to the west of the existing known mineralisation and continue to encounter strong nickel mineralisation in the supergene zone.’ ‘In addition, we’ve been pushing some of the holes deeper (towards 200 metres) and encountering wide intercepts of disseminated sulphides, which bodes well for the upcoming drilling program to test Anomaly One at Wyatt’s’. Drilling also included five drill holes over Anomalies 2 & 3 to facilitate Down Hole Electromagnetics (‘DHEM’) to test for the potential of massive sulphides at depth within these target areas. A number of these drill holes were also extended well into fresh rock due to the presence of sulphides in the drill chips. Wide intercepts of sulphides were observed in a number of drill holes, particularly adjacent to ‘Anomaly 3’. Sulphides included pyrite and pyrrhotite, with assaying showing this mineralisation to be anomalous in both copper (up to 520 ppm) and scandium (~40 ppm). The relevance of these sulphides to the mineralised system will be further investigated as exploration continues at Quicksilver. | |
